Whilst other sub-genres have progressed with time, acid house arrived absolutely formed. The foundational tune, “Acid Tracks” by DJ Pierre, Herb J and also the late Earl “Spanky” Smith, arrived similar to a bolt from out on the blue, and nevertheless sounds untouchably Highly developed to today. It turned the Roland TB-303 bassline generator — an Practically out of date synth which was at first intended as a straightforward automated accompanist for solo musicians — into the most iconic instrument in all of dance music.

House music is usually a musical genre birthed in Chicago inside the eighties. With roots in disco, the house works by using an analogous beat and song construction but combines it with electronic aspects, samples, and synthesizers.

House music pioneers Alan King, Robert Williams and Derrick Carter A person reserve from 2009 states the title "house music" originated from the Chicago club known as the Warehouse that was open up from 1977 to 1982.[23] Clubbers for the Warehouse have been mostly black gay Males,[24][25] who arrived to dance to music played with the club's resident DJ, Frankie Knuckles, who followers refer to given that the "godfather of house". Frankie started the development of splicing alongside one another distinctive records when he discovered that the documents he experienced were not very long sufficient to satisfy his audience of dancers.

House music, as we'd arrive at understand it, was a great deal like my DJ sets experienced constantly been: described with the generate to produce individuals dance,” he explained to Medium Cuepoint.
